'We are voluntarily abdicating our role and it's the Russians, Iranians and others who are benefitting,' Richard Haas warned.

"President Trump was definitely out-negotiated and only endorsed the troop withdraw to make it look like we are getting something—but we are not getting something," the source said."The U.S. national security has entered a state of increased danger for decades to come because the president has no spine, and that's the bottom line.

President Donald Trump and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an hold a bilateral meeting on the sidelines of the G-20 Summit in Osaka, Japan on June 29"The Trump administration has made a grave mistake that will have implications far beyond Syria," Senator Marco Rubio, a Republican from Florida, wrote on Twitter.
